Hot rolled (Hot rolled sheet)refers to hot-rolled coil, which is produced from slabs (mainly continuous cast slabs) as raw materials. After heating, it is processed by roughing and finishing mills to create strip steel. The hot strip steel that comes out of the last finishing mill is air-cooled to a set temperature and then coiled into rolls by the coiling machine, resulting in cooled Steel Coils.

1. Major Specifications and Materials

Hot-rolled steel coils are widely used across industries due to their versatility and cost-effectiveness. Below are the primary specifications and materials dominating the market:

  • Common Grades:

    • Q235B/Q355B: Standard Carbon Steels for structural applications, with yield strengths of 235 MPa and 345 MPa, respectively. Widely used in construction and machinery due to excellent weldability and affordability36.

    • SS400: A Japanese standard grade equivalent to Q235B, ideal for general construction and industrial frameworks6.

    • 09CuPCrNi-A: Weather-resistant steel for corrosion-prone environments, such as bridges and shipping containers56.

    • ASME SA516 Gr.70: High-strength boiler-grade steel with enhanced pressure resistance, critical for industrial boilers and pressure vessels7.

  • Dimensions:

    • Thickness: 1.2–16 mm (standard), up to 20 mm for heavy-duty applications27.

    • Width: 1,010–3,400 mm, catering to diverse fabrication needs26.

4. Global Standards and Production

  • ISO 20805:2005: Though obsolete, this standard laid groundwork for high-yield, formable hot-rolled coils in cold-forming applications1.

  • ASTM/JIS Alignment: Materials like Q345B align with ASTM A572 Gr.50, facilitating international trade6.
